> >Deleting the old firmware is a bad idea.  You've haven't modified the driver in
> >net or net-next to use the new firmware, and until you do, kernels won't be able
> >to find the firmware the driver is requesting.  You should make firmware changes
> >addative.  Add new versions of firmware, but keep the old ones (at least for a
> >while).  Thank you for moving cxgb4 to a versioned firmware file though.  I
> >presume there is a pending update to change the FW_FNAME definition to pending?
> 
> Hi Neil,
> 
> Thank you for the review. I have updated the patch series with the
> following changes:
> - Rename the existing t4fw.bin file as t4fw-1.3.10.0.bin
> - Add t4fw.bin as a symlink to the latest t4fw revision.
> 
Thank you, that helps. 

> The driver looks up "t4fw.bin", the symlink allows updates of the FW
> without actually modifying the driver source.
> Also, if the firmware revision under /lib/firmware/cxgb4/t4fw.bin is
> more recent than the adapter's embedded FW,
> the driver will update it. The FW revisions are forward compatible.
> 
Thats fine, I presume then we can expect a commit to the cxgb3 driver shortly,
updatnig the FW_VERSION_MINOR macro?
